Police say fire at unoccupied Strathpine home suspicious

A house listed for sale has been destroyed overnight in a fire police have deemed as suspicious

Police are investigating a suspicious fire at Strathpine overnight.

Emergency services were called to a house fire on Rosewood Drive around 2.15am.

A Queensland Fire Department spokesman said two crews arrived at the scene and the fire was extinguished at 2.45am.

The Courier Mail understands the house was listed for sale.

A crime scene has been declared and police are investigating the fire, no injuries were reported.
